Output 8c5648be0a50870f0f2d21f88fab2874b53711752b0be48a864c3bc7060ea7e2:0

value
420579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 734e05d5ed7ad8e9557c0185599c9580f3cb447d OP_EQUAL
address
3CCh6itqoarSwJ5fJARLXwa9Sa6LFYjLUA
transaction
8c5648be0a50870f0f2d21f88fab2874b53711752b0be48a864c3bc7060ea7e2
spent
true